IHG’s Vignette Collection Reaches Milestone of 10 Open Hotels in Greater China

  • LODGING Staff
  • 3 February 2026
🏨 IHG's Vignette Collection reached 10 open hotels in Greater China since its 2023 entry. Launched globally in 2021, the collection enhances urban renewal while respecting local culture. At THE ONE Shanghai Downtown, it partners with local artists, supporting educational initiatives. Vignette's ethos emphasizes authenticity, aiming for memorable guest experiences. The brand plans further expansion, boosting IHG's luxury and lifestyle presence in the region.

Sustainability is Everywhere: Except in Hospitality Culture

  • Automatic
  • 3 February 2026
🏨 Hospitality industry faces sustainability challenges. Over 40 years, sustainability frameworks like Green Key, LEED, and EarthCheck expanded, yet practical integration lags (UNWTO, 2021; WTTC, 2022). Deloitte (2023) and McKinsey (2021) report low employee engagement due to unaligned tasks and lack of impact visibility. Sustainability actions, often treated as transactional, fail to become cultural, as noted by Harvard Business Review (2018). Leaders must embed sustainability into daily activities to achieve meaningful change.

Red Roof Announces Partnership With Canine Companions

  • LODGING Staff
  • 2 February 2026
💰 Red Roof partners with Canine Companions from February 2 to February 26, 2026, to support service dog provision. Guests staying at Red Roof Inn, Red Roof PLUS+, HomeTowne Studios by Red Roof, or The Red Collection can save 15% and have 5% of their purchase donated. Since 1975, Canine Companions has placed over 8,400 service dogs. The initiative is part of Red Roof's Room In Your Heart program, which previously supported organizations like St. Jude and United Way.

Apex Hotels and QMU relaunch scholarship partnership

  • Cynera Rodricks
  • 2 February 2026
📚 Apex Hotels and Queen Margaret University rekindled their partnership in January 2026 to launch a scholarship program for hospitality students. Apex will invest £60,000 over four years, aiding up to 20 students with £3,000 each. The first cohort includes five students, chosen in January at Edinburgh's Apex Waterloo Place Hotel. The initiative provides financial aid, industry insights, networking, and job opportunities, reinforcing Scotland's hospitality talent pipeline.

Jet2.com reaches 100% electric ground…

  • Kate Harden-England1
  • 2 February 2026
🚀 Jet2.com has achieved a milestone at Newcastle Airport by transitioning all its owned ground service equipment (GSE) to 100% electric power. This aligns with its goal to reduce emissions and enhance air quality, aiming for a 99% reduction in GSE emissions by 2035. Paul Southall, Head of Sustainability, emphasizes their commitment to sustainability through electrification efforts. The initiative also includes electric crew buses and a salary-exchange scheme for electric cars across the UK.

Shatterproof honors Marriott International CEO with Hospitality Hero Award

  • Denis Stackeusky
  • 30 January 2026
💸 Anthony Capuano, CEO of Marriott International, received the 2026 Shatterproof Hospitality Hero Award at the Ninth Annual Shatterproof Hospitality Heroes Reception in Los Angeles, CA. The event, aligned with ALIS, raised $2.1 million with 75 participating hospitality companies. Founded by Gary Mendell in 2012, Shatterproof has raised over $12 million since 2016. Data reveals 17% of hospitality employees had substance use disorders, prompting industry-wide efforts to reduce stigma and support well-being.

AHLA and IHLA Hold No Room for Trafficking Seminar

  • LODGING Staff
  • 30 January 2026
🏨 CHICAGO, January—Over 100 local hotel employees received training at the Sheraton Grand Chicago Riverwalk to identify and report human trafficking. Illinois Attorney General Kwame Raoul and Mayor Brandon Johnson emphasized hotel roles in prevention. The seminar, hosted by the Illinois and American Hotel & Lodging Associations, concluded National Human Trafficking Prevention Month. Hotel staff are crucial in detecting and reporting suspicious activities, supporting community safety and protecting victims.
